Bromas, S.A Ending Explained: Eccentric millionaire hires a team of young people to help him stage practical jokes. Directed by Alberto Mariscal, this 1967 comedy film stars Gloria Marín (Martina Pérez y Pérez), alongside Mauricio Garcés as Alberto/Rogelio Naveda, Antonio Badú as Elías Arnoff, Manuel Valdés as Benjamín.
